BBQ Tofu Parmesan

Hey lovelies been a minute since I have shared one of my dishes with you but I've been abundantly blessed with several new things that I have my hands on and I am still working out the kinks so my time is well divided amongst all that I love to do.

Today's share is my what the heck can I make before I sit down for three hours to watch the Live Musical Hairspray? Thursday's Treat...BBQ Tofu Parmesan!

Ingredients:
-2 1lb packs extra firm Tofu
-breadcrumbs
-olive oil
-Italian seasoning
-garlic powder
-salt
-parm cheese
-mozzarella cheese
-BBQ sauce

Mix 1/2 cup of breadcrumbs,  2tsps of Italian seasoning, 1/2tsp of garlic powder,  1/2tsp of salt and 1/2 cup of parm cheese in a large bowl. Take 2 packs of the firm Tofu and cut into 1/4 thick slices. I am using 2 packs so I can have left overs and also serve 4 people. Set aside and in a large skillet on medium heat add 2tbsps of olive oil. Coat your slices of Tofu and when oil is hot place them in skillet cook each side till lightly browned which is about 5 minutes each.


Cut up half a pack of Mozzarella cheese and slice to your liking and place pieces on top of Tofu cover for a few minutes till they melt and drizzle with BBQ sauce and done!

Broiled Eggplant with melted Pepper Jack Cheese

Thursday's Treat...Broiled Eggplant with melted Pepper Jack Cheese!

Ingredients:
-eggplant
-olive oil
-cheese
-balsamic vinegar
-salt
-lemon pepper
-oregano
-Sazon Tropical (or any fav herbs)


In a large boil add 1 1/2tbsps of Balsamic Vin, 3tbsps of olive oil, 1/4tsp of oregano, pinch of salt, lemon pepper to your liking, Sazon Tropical to your liking. Mix well and set aside. Take 2 large eggplants cut in half then slice again in 1/4 or 1/2 inch pieces depends on how many you are serving and with your cooking brush coat the eggplant or just dip in the mix. Make sure both sides are coated evenly. Using your baking tray spray Pam or whatever non stick method you use and lay pieces out evenly. Set broiler for 6 minutes turn and set for another 4 minutes this time adding a small slice of your favorite cheese I used Pepper Jack. When cheese begins to bubble shut off and remove. Ground Turkey Sloppy Joes Italian style

Thursday's Treat...Ground Turkey Sloppy Joes Italian style

Ingredients: 
-ground turkey
-pasta sauce
-olive oil
-sweet peppers
-oregano
-onion powder
-crushed red pepper flakes
-spinach

One of the reasons I love ground Turkey is because it cooks down quickly, that and I rarely eat red meats or pork. In a large bowl I mixed 2 lbs of ground turkey, 2tbsps onion powder (you can use handful of chopped red onions I just didn't have any in hand), 2tbsps ground oregano, 1 1/2tbps crushed red pepper flakes,handful spinach and 6 small sweet peppers cut to bite sizes.

Heat large skillet on medium add 2tbsps of olive oil add ground turkey mix and cook 8 minutes add sauce cook 10 minutes.

Barbecue Tofu & Spaghetti

Thursday's Treat...Barbecue Tofu & Spaghetti!

Ingredients:
-firm tofu
-pasta
-bbq sauce
-garlic powder or cloves
-onion powder or red onions
-olive oil
-salt
-plum tomatoes
-mushrooms or other veggie


Cook your pasta, I chose Spaghetti, to your liking which for me is 12 minutes. I used 2 packs of firm tofu removed the water and cut into 1 inch squares, took handful of mushrooms and sliced 1/4 inch and set aside. In a large skillet on medium heat I added 2tbsps olive oil, 2tbsps garlic powder, 2tbsps onion powder and a pinch of salt. As it simmered I added the tofu and mushrooms and covered for 10 minutes. After 10 minutes I add BBQ sauce to my liking which was 1 cup and cooked another ten minutes.

Served with additional plum tomatoes as another topping, Delish! Great flavor lite no heavy sauce or oils very tasty and easy clean up. Enjoy!
